ROMS uses an Arakawa "C" Grid. The grid can be specified using analytical functions or with a netcdf file. To create a netcdf grid file, there are sevearl grid generation tools. A popular grid generation tool is "seagrid" available at: http://woodshole.er.usgs.gov/staffpages/cdenham/public_html/seagrid/seagrid.html
